For return on investment in value, no school beat Brigham Young University Idaho this year. Set in the town of Rexburg, Brigham Young University Idaho is a very large private not-for-profit institution. Students from in state pay about $4,800 in tuition and fees. Students borrow a median of $13,287 to complete the value program here. Value graduates of Brigham Young University Idaho earn a median of $43,853 early in their careers. Weighed against typical debt, the earnings make a compelling case for value. Brigham Young University Idaho admits about 96% of applicants.

Utah Valley University is a great value for students pursuing a degree in value, landing the #2 spot this year. Utah Valley University is a very large public school located in the city of Orem. The average in-state cost of tuition and fees is $6,507, with out-of-state students paying around $18,489. Students borrow a median of $16,478 to complete the value program here. Value graduates of Utah Valley University earn a median of $51,242 early in their careers. That is a strong return on a $16,478 median debt.

Notes and References

This ranking is produced by College Factual (MF_RANKING_2025), 2026 edition. Schools are scored on the balance of cost (tuition and student debt) against student outcomes (post-graduation earnings) — a measure of return on investment, drawn primarily from the U.S. Department of Education (IPEDS and College Scorecard).

Ranking method: College Major Best Value · 20 schools evaluated.
